Canada Invests $77M to Tackle Driver Inc. Scheme

Story summary
- The Canadian federal government will allocate $77 million over four years starting in 2026-27 to combat the Driver Inc. scheme.
- The funding includes ongoing annual support of $19.2 million for the Canada Revenue Agency (CRA).
- The moratorium on penalties for unreported fees-for-service transactions in the trucking industry will be lifted.
- The plan will implement a program targeting non-compliance in personal services businesses.
